返回

PicGo+Cloudflare+MinIO搭建私人图床,开启你的图片管理新时代

开发工具

私人图床搭建指南:摆脱图片限制,掌控您的内容

导语:

在当今图片无处不在的数字世界中,管理和分享图片已成为一个不可或缺的挑战。对于个人博主、摄影师和企业而言,公共图床的限制和成本往往阻碍了他们的创作和分发。本文将带您逐步了解如何使用 PicGo、Cloudflare 和 MinIO 建立自己的私人图床,为您提供安全、稳定且经济实惠的图片管理解决方案。

PicGo:您的图片管理枢纽

PicGo 是一款跨平台的图床上传工具,支持多种流行的云存储服务,例如 AWS S3、Azure Blob 存储和 Google Cloud Storage。它提供了一个直观的用户界面,可让您轻松上传、管理和分享您的图片。通过 PicGo,您可以告别图床空间限制、缓慢的加载速度和严格的版权限制。

Cloudflare:您的网络安全卫士

Cloudflare 是一家全球知名的 CDN(内容分发网络)提供商,以其出色的性能和安全功能而闻名。借助 Cloudflare,您可以加速网站加载速度、保护您的服务器免受 DDoS 攻击,并通过免费的内网穿透服务将您的本地服务器暴露到公网上。

MinIO:您的对象存储专家

MinIO 是一款开源的对象存储服务,专为处理大规模非结构化数据而设计。它提供无限的可扩展性和高性能,非常适合构建您的私人图床。与传统的文件系统不同,MinIO 将数据存储在扁平的名称空间中,从而简化了管理并提供了卓越的性能。

搭建步骤:打造您的私人图床

1. 安装 PicGo

前往 PicGo 官网下载并安装 PicGo 应用程序,适用于 Windows、macOS 和 Linux。

2. 注册 Cloudflare 账户

访问 Cloudflare 网站并注册一个免费账户。

3. 创建 Cloudflare 隧道

登录 Cloudflare 控制面板,导航至“隧道”>“创建隧道”。设置隧道名称、服务器 IP 和端口,然后单击“创建隧道”。

4. 安装 MinIO

下载并安装 MinIO 软件,适用于 Windows、macOS 和 Linux。

5. 创建 MinIO 存储桶

打开 MinIO 控制面板,导航至“存储桶”>“创建存储桶”。输入存储桶名称和区域,然后单击“创建存储桶”。

6. 配置 PicGo

打开 PicGo 应用程序,单击“设置”>“图床”。选择“MinIO”图床并按照提示输入 MinIO 的访问密钥、端口和存储桶名称。

7. 测试图床

上传一张图片到您的图床并验证图像链接是否能正常显示。

结语:释放您的创造潜力

通过搭建您的私人图床,您可以突破图床限制,获得对图片内容的完全控制。您将享受更快的加载速度、无限的存储空间和灵活的版权管理。无论是个人博客、摄影网站还是商业应用程序,自己的图床都将为您提供额外的自由和灵活性,让您专注于您的创作,而不是技术限制。

常见问题解答

1. 为什么要搭建我的私人图床?

搭建私人图床可以为您带来多项好处,包括不受图床限制、更高的安全性、更快的加载速度以及对图片内容的完全控制。

2. PicGo、Cloudflare 和 MinIO 如何协同工作?

PicGo 用于上传和管理图片。Cloudflare 提供 CDN 加速和内网穿透服务,将您的图片快速安全地分发给用户。MinIO 作为图片存储库,提供无限的可扩展性和高性能。

3. 搭建私人图床的成本是多少?

搭建私人图床的成本取决于您选择的云存储服务。MinIO 是一个免费的开源解决方案,而 Cloudflare 提供免费和付费服务层。

4. 我的图片会在搭建私人图床后消失吗?

不会。您的图片将安全地存储在您自己控制的 MinIO 存储桶中。

5. 我可以将我的私人图床与其他应用程序集成吗?

可以。PicGo 支持多种第三方集成,包括 Markdown 编辑器、代码编辑器和内容管理系统。